    Speak to all the congregation of Israel, saying, "On the tenth of this month every man shall take for himself a lamb, according to each house of his father, a lamb for a household." Exodus 12:3

    The sacrificial lamb, a type and shadow of the Lamb of God, yet to come in the distant future. God told Moses to have the children of Israel kill their lamb and smear some of the blood over the doorpost of their home and when the Death Angel would see it, He would pass over! This began the feast of the Passover.

    Jesus is our sacrificial lamb slain for us to cleanse us from our sins and iniquities. His death, burial and resurrection set us free from the bondage of sin and death! The story of the deliverance of the children of Israel from Egypt depicts our deliverance from the bonds of sin by the cleansing of the blood of Christ!

    As the people of God ate the Passover meal it represents the modern-day communion, we celebrate to remember what the Lord Jesus has done for us just as the Jews remember what God did for them in their deliverance from Egypt.

    He has delivered us from the power of darkness and conveyed us into the kingdom of the Son of His love, in whom we have redemption through His blood, the forgiveness of sins. He is the image of the invisible God, the firstborn over all creation. Colossians 1:13-15
